An update on the new public middle school coming to Pacific Park

New York Yimby has an update on the construction of the mixed-use building at 664 Pacific in Prospect Heights which states that construction has started. The 343,788-square-foot, mixed-use building will rise 26 stories and bring 323 rental units to the neighborhood. The property sits at the corner of Dean Street and Sixth Avenue and is directly to the east of Barclays Center and is part of Pacific Park. It will also be home to a District 13 new middle school which might be called M.S. One Brooklyn. The 616-seat public middle school that will span the first five floors and two below-grade levels is now scheduled to open in September 2022 which means current 2nd Graders would be the first students at the school. No details on the programming of the middle school have been published by the Department of Education, however, there have been parenting initiatives to launch a dual language program as well as a STEM curriculum at the school.
